Position Summary
The Audit & Compliance Clerk is responsible for ensuring timely and accurate completion of client-driven audits throughout the year, for performing and maintaining documentation of periodic control reporting, internal auditing, and for reviewing and submitting account-level special handling issues including but not limited to complaints, disputes, and fraud claims.
The Audit & Compliance Clerk must have the ability to work independently on projects, to work well under pressure, and to handle a wide variety of duties. The ideal individual will have strong written and verbal communication, organizational skills, and the ability to balance multiple priorities.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
The essential functions include, but are not limited to the following:
- Attend and participate in weekly meetings with the Audit & Compliance team to discuss current or potential compliance issues
- Provide client audit deliverables as instructed by the Audit & Compliance Supervisor and Lead
- Perform periodic controls and internal auditing as assigned in the Audit & Compliance Task List
- Maintain the Accountability Log to ensure all identified issues are being addressed timely
- Identify, document, and submit complaints, disputes, and other special handling items to clients according to their work standards
- Work with other departments to find root cause for identified issues and work in a collaborative manner to remediate those issues
